Questions, answered.
- What is Certara, Inc.'s reportable segment — cost of revenues?
- Certara, Inc. (CERT) reported reportable segment — cost of revenues of $1.92M in Q1 2026.
- How has Certara, Inc.'s reportable segment — cost of revenues changed year-over-year?
- Certara, Inc.'s reportable segment — cost of revenues increased by 12.1% year-over-year, from $1.72M to $1.92M.
- What is the long-term trend for Certara, Inc.'s reportable segment — cost of revenues?
- Over 3 years (2022 to 2025), Certara, Inc.'s reportable segment — cost of revenues has grown at a 18.6%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$4.24M to $7.07M.
- What does reportable segment — cost of revenues mean?
- This metric encompasses the direct costs associated with delivering the segment's services and software, excluding indirect overheads. It is a key indicator of the segment's gross margin efficiency and the direct profitability of its service delivery model. Lower costs relative to revenue suggest a highly scalable and efficient service or software delivery process.
